Discover the cultural richness and artistic vibrancy of Montreux.
1 Apr - 23 Nov 2025
Montreux
2 Sep - 23 Nov 2025
8 Nov - 8 Nov 2025
12 Nov - 16 Nov 2025
14 Nov - 19 Dec 2025
20 Nov - 20 Nov 2025
20 Nov - 24 Dec 2025
26 Dec - 26 Dec 2025